The Position

J Street is seeking an intern for its Development department in our Washington, DC headquarters. This is an ideal position for applicants who want to gain knowledge about the non-profit and political fundraising world in a fast-paced and highly-engaged advocacy organization. The J Street Development department raises the operational budget of J Street and the J Street Education Fund ($12 million per year) as well as the political campaign contributions to congressional candidates through JStreetPAC (over $15.5 million in the 2024 election cycle). Working with the Development team allows fellows to touch on every aspect of J Street’s work from the communal to the political while learning valuable, transferable skills in research, database management, and donor relations.

About J Street

J Street organizes pro-Israel, pro-peace, pro-democracy Americans to promote US policies that align with Jewish and democratic values, that help secure the State of Israel as a just, democratic homeland for the Jewish people, and that advance freedom, safety and self-determination for the Palestinian people.

J Street focuses its work in three main areas: (1) Advocating and demonstrating support for pro-Israel, pro-peace, pro-democracy policies in Congress, the media and the Jewish community; (2) Endorsing and raising money for federal candidates who share J Street’s agenda; and (3) Educating the public and raising awareness of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ict and the two-state solution.
